
Nashville, TN (March 3, 2008) ---- Fans have been eagerly waiting for the latest CD from Michael English, which is his first
studio project in eight years. The result is a #10 listing on iTunes Christian in the first week of release for
The Prodigal Comes Home.
The majority of the album was produced by Mark Miller (Sawyer Brown, Casting Crowns) and Dale Oliver (Bucky Covington) and showcases such top songwriters as Neil Thrasher (Rascal Flatts, Kenny Chesney), Matthew West (Natalie Grant), Sam Mizell (Point of Grace, Avalon), to name a few.
“Michael put his heart and soul into this album and we are thrilled to be able to work such a great project,” says Bryan Stewart, Vice President, Curb Records.
Early reviews on the project include ChristianMusicToday, “….the years out of the spotlight have been remarkably kind to English's voice, which sounds as impressive as ever—a surefire contender for Male Vocalist at the 2009 Dove awards.” CMCentral, “….’The Only Thing Good In Me.’ Written by Ronnie Freeman and Tony Wood, this track reigns as the album centerpiece, full of heart, and also showcases the still strong vocal powers of English.” More reviews and features are coming up in the near future.
